Monthly Archives: November 2011

Exploring the Planets Enriches Us at Home

NEW YORK — NASA’s newest marvel, a one-ton rover named Curiosity, has been set down with all the delicacy of a carton of eggs on the surface of Mars. The perfect landing came after a complex series of automated maneuvers … Continued